What is Data Removal and Destruction?

Data Removal and Destruction is a related problem when businesses dispose of PCs or other electronic equipment containing sensitive business information.

Under the data protection act, if disposal of your equipment is not properly controlled, unlimited fines can be imposed on the owner of the equipment.

The Data Destruction Process
Deleting or reformatting hard disk drives does not completely remove data.

To ensure compliance with the Data Protection Act. Any residual data on your redundant assets should be destroyed to government standards. Failure to comply will expose a business to the possibility of financial penalties.

A certificate of compliance is then produced if required.
